League of Women Voters Program Will Highlight Health Care in Colorado

Archuleta League of Women Voters, a non-partisan, non-profit, education and advocacy organization, is pleased to announce a presentation of “Affordable and Comprehensive Health Care for ALL Coloradans” on Tuesday March 24, 5:30pm at Community United Methodist Church, 434 Lewis Street.

The program will cover a Colorado School of Public Health study related to a new Colorado law (SB25-045 May 2025) looking at a single non-profit, publicly financed, privately delivered comprehensive healthcare system.

The study has been funded and will evaluate how comprehensive healthcare (medical, dental, vision, hearing, drugs, psychiatric care
and long-term care) can be brought to Coloradans, with no deductibles, no co-pays and based on households’ ability to pay.

Speakers will include:

Eileen Monyok, Board of Colorado Healthcare Coalition: “What will healthcare study entail and how will it help Coloradans”

Robert Hagberg MD, Colorado Heathcare Coalition: “How Would a Single Payer System change our current system” and “Experience with New Zealand’s Single Payer Universal Healthcare System”
